Types of Companies in Bahrain
Choosing the proper business structure to start your own business is crucial. The following are the different types of legal entity structures:
- With Limited Liability Company (WLL): A With Limited Liability Company(WLL), commonly known as a Limited Liability Company(LLC), is one of the popular types of business setup for foreign investors in the Kingdom of Bahrain. This structure safeguards shareholders’ personal assets, limiting liabilities to their capital contributions.
- Branch of a Foreign Company: Company Law in Bahrain allows foreign investors to set up a branch office without setting up a subsidiary.
- Commercial Agencies: An individual or company in Bahrain can be appointed as a commercial agency by the overseas parent companies. The commercial agency can offer services and distribute goods on behalf of the parent company.
- Representative Trade Office: Overseas parent companies can form the representative trade office in Bahrain, appointing a local agent. The parent companies can conduct research and promote their business in Bahrain but cannot indulge in profit-making activities.
- General Partnership Company: The partners with similar responsibilities and liability to the extent of their personal wealth can come together to form a General partnership company in Bahrain. There should be at least two partners, and there is no maximum limit for the number of partners in such a company.
- Limited Share Partnership Company: General Partners engaged in the managerial activities and with the liability extending to their personal wealth, along with the Limited Partners liable to the extent of their investment, can form a limited share partnership company. The business activities such as Banking, Insurance and Investments are not allowed for this type of business.
- Holding Company: This type of company is formed by investors to gain managerial control over the subsidiaries by investing more than 51 % of their capital share. As a subsidiary, holding companies can form different types of businesses such as SPC, JPC or LLC.
- Joint Venture: Two organizations for entities working together on a common business objective can form a joint venture. This type of company cannot enjoy the status of a legal entity. A Joint Venture can be dissolved on completion of the target, expiry of the contract or due to some other legal reasons.
Steps for start your own business
After selecting the suitable business structure for your company, you can start the process of company formation. The following are the steps involved in company formation in Bahrain:
- Security Clearance: A security clearance is a background check from the Ministry of Interior to ensure eligibility and potential security concerns. One must submit a copy of the passport and other identification documents to the Ministry of Interior for all the company owners and directors for security clearance check.
- Register Your Business Name: Choose and register your company’s unique name with the Ministry of Industry, Commerce and Tourism (MOICT) for availability checks and approval. The selective name must comply with Bahrain’s naming conventions and must not be any existing trademarks.
- Provide an Office Address: Provide the address of a registered office. It can be a physical office space, a work desk in a shared workspace, or even a virtual office address in Bahrain. Consider cost, scalability, and professional image when choosing an office address and it must comply with municipal regulations for the approval of the address from relevant authorities.
- Draft and Notarize Legal Documents: Draft a Memorandum of Association (MOA) outlining your company’s structure, including company name, objectives, share capital, and management structure. Once drafted, the MOA needs to be notarized by the Ministry of Justice. Then submit the MOA with other relevant documents to the Ministry of Justice for notarization.
- Open a Corporate Bank Account: Open a corporate bank account and deposit the minimum required capital for your chosen business into the account. Then you will receive a capital deposit certificate from the bank for finalizing the company registration process.
- Get Final Approval from MOICT: The final step includes submitting the notarized memorandum and bank certificate to MOCIT for ultimate approval. Once approved, your company formation is officially declared.
